Casino promotions are often presented as a shortcut to extra play, yet the real value usually hides in the terms rather than the headline. A polished banner may promise more funds, while the wagering rules quietly sit in the corner like a bouncer checking the guest list. Anyone comparing offers should start with the conditions, not the confetti.

What a Casino Bonus Actually Includes

Most welcome offers combine several elements: a deposit match, free spins, a wagering requirement, and a deadline. These parts work together, so judging one figure in isolation can produce a distorted impression. A 100% match sounds clear until the maximum qualifying deposit, eligible games, and withdrawal cap enter the conversation.

  • Deposit match: extra promotional funds linked to a qualifying payment.
  • Free spins: game-specific rounds that may apply only to selected slots.
  • Wagering requirement: the number of times bonus funds, or sometimes deposit and bonus funds, must be played through.
  • Maximum stake: the highest permitted wager while the promotion is active.
  • Expiry period: the time allowed to complete the offer before it disappears.

Some operators use a “sticky” bonus, meaning promotional funds cannot be withdrawn even after the wagering target is reached. Others remove only the bonus amount and leave qualifying winnings available. That distinction is not decorative legal language; it can materially change the result of a successful session.

Reading Wagering Requirements Without Guesswork

Numbers become meaningful only when the calculation is understood. Suppose a promotion grants £50 and carries a 35x bonus wagering requirement. The target is £1,750 in qualifying wagers. If the rule applies to deposit plus bonus, a £50 deposit would create a £100 base and a £3,500 target. The difference is rather larger than the font used to announce it.

Term Question to ask Why it matters
Wagering base Is it bonus only or deposit plus bonus? Determines the total playthrough target.
Game contribution Do slots count at 100%? Table games may contribute less or nothing.
Maximum stake Does the limit include bonus rounds? A breach may void the promotion.
Withdrawal rule Are winnings capped or restricted? Controls how much can ultimately be removed.

Slot games commonly contribute fully, while roulette, blackjack, baccarat, and live dealer titles may contribute partially. Some games are excluded altogether. A player who chooses a low-contribution table game to clear a slot-focused offer may discover that the wagering meter moves with the enthusiasm of a broken escalator.

RTP, Volatility, and the Cost of Time

Mathematical return also deserves a place in the assessment. A higher theoretical RTP does not guarantee a winning session, and volatility affects how sharply balances rise and fall. Low-volatility games may produce smaller, steadier outcomes; high-volatility titles can deliver larger swings and longer dry spells. Neither category turns wagering into a reliable income stream.

Consider a £1,750 wagering target played on a game with a theoretical 96% RTP. The expected mathematical loss is not a promise of what will happen, but it illustrates the price of turnover: roughly £70 over the full volume before other restrictions are considered. Luck can ignore the spreadsheet, naturally, but the spreadsheet remains the more honest companion.

Payment Methods and Withdrawal Checks

Payment speed is often discussed as if every method behaves identically. It does not. Cards may process deposits quickly but take longer for withdrawals, while e-wallets can be faster where supported. Bank transfers may suit larger withdrawals but require patience. The available options should be checked before accepting a promotion, especially if the bonus blocks certain withdrawal routes.

  • Confirm whether the chosen payment method is eligible for both deposits and withdrawals.
  • Check minimum and maximum transaction limits.
  • Review pending periods and processing times.
  • Prepare identity documents before requesting a substantial withdrawal.
  • Verify that the account name matches the payment account.

Know-your-customer checks are routine at regulated casinos. A request for identification is not automatically a warning sign, although unexplained delays and shifting document demands deserve careful scrutiny. A reputable operator should explain what is required, why it is needed, and how documents are handled.

Safer Play Should Be Part of the Comparison

Responsible gambling tools are practical controls, not sombre wallpaper. Deposit limits, cooling-off periods, session reminders, and self-exclusion options can help keep entertainment within a defined budget. The most useful limit is the one chosen before emotion starts negotiating like a persuasive bookmaker.

Set a spending ceiling that does not affect rent, bills, savings, or routine expenses. Treat losses as entertainment costs rather than temporary debts waiting to be recovered. Chasing turns a promotional offer into a small financial treadmill, and treadmills are impressive only when nobody is pretending they are taking you somewhere.

A Sensible Final Check Before Claiming

Before opting in, read the full promotional page and the general bonus policy. Check the wagering base, game contributions, maximum stake, expiry date, withdrawal restrictions, and any rules covering multiple accounts or irregular play. If the wording is unclear, ask support for a written answer and retain a copy.

Casino bonuses can reduce the cost of recreational play, but they are not free money and they do not soften the house edge. A measured comparison focuses on transparency, payment reliability, licensing, and control tools. The strongest offer is often not the loudest one; it is the one whose conditions remain understandable after the banner has stopped flashing.
